Output 21c99e4e7e738e3d927960d61e538542535eb0f5a9da9017c6be8a4fb8616302:6

value
14228326
script pubkey
OP_0 OP_PUSHBYTES_32 090994a77fe3600324d8627c69542e7a33107309cf1484227a2acbbbbc28e17f
address
bc1qpyyeffmludsqxfxcvf7xj4pw0ge3qucfeu2gggn69t9mh0pgu9lsehq0h2
transaction
21c99e4e7e738e3d927960d61e538542535eb0f5a9da9017c6be8a4fb8616302
confirmations
60548
spent
true